Cursive Vidi 7 is a regular weight, normal width, medium contrast, italic, short x-height font.

A lively, slanted handwritten script with brush-pen character and visibly human stroke rhythm. Letterforms are rounded and loop-driven, with soft terminals and occasional ink-like swelling that creates gentle contrast. Connections appear intermittently, producing a cursive flow without forcing every character into a continuous join. Proportions are relaxed and slightly irregular, with a bouncy baseline feel and generous, open counters that keep the texture airy at display sizes.
Works best for short to medium text where a handwritten presence is desirable—greeting cards, invitations, product packaging, posters, and social graphics. It also suits pull quotes, headings, and signature-like accents where its lively rhythm can be a feature rather than a distraction.
The overall tone is personable and upbeat, like quick note-taking with a confident marker. Its motion and looping forms suggest warmth and spontaneity rather than strict precision, giving text an inviting, conversational voice.
Designed to emulate natural, everyday cursive writing with a brushy, energetic cadence. The intent appears focused on friendliness and immediacy—capturing the charm of hand-drawn lettering while remaining clear enough for common display use.
Caps are simple and readable with a handwritten ease, while lowercase introduces more distinctive loops (notably in descenders and round letters) that add flair. Numerals match the same casual, pen-drawn logic, keeping the set consistent for informal messaging and headings.
